This is a demo store. No orders will be fulfilled.

Check out our race nights

Schumacher Bumper and Body Mounts - Mission,Fusion,Menace (U2457)

Out of stock

SKU
U2457
  £8.07
Get a price match

Description / Schumacher Bumper and Body Mounts - Mission,Fusion,Menace (U2457)

Schumacher Bumper and Body Mounts - Mission,Fusion,Menace (U2457)